License Renewal Application Reminder for Radio Stations in Delaware and Pennsylvania and Television Stations in Texas

Full power commercial and noncommercial radio, LPFM, and FM Translator stations, licensed to communities in Delaware and Pennsylvania, and full power TV, Class A TV, LPTV, and TV Translator stations licensed to communities in Texas, must file their license renewal applications by April 1, 2022. Annual EEO Public File Report Deadline for Stations in Arkansas, Kansas, Louisiana, Mississippi, Nebraska, New Jersey, New York, and Oklahoma

February 1 is the deadline for broadcast stations licensed to communities in Arkansas, Kansas, Louisiana, Mississippi, Nebraska, New Jersey, New York, and Oklahoma to place their Annual EEO Public File Report in their Public Inspection File and post the report on their station website. 2021 Fourth Quarter Issues/Programs List Advisory for Broadcast Stations

The next Quarterly Issues/Programs List (“Quarterly List”) must be placed in stations’ Public Inspection Files by January 10, 2022, reflecting information for the months of October, November, and December 2021.
